  Chapter 135 Deathwing Company (for subscription)

  The booming explosion shook the earth.

  A large amount of dust was kicked up, and then fell under the pull of the planet's gravity.

   fell on the Cadia soldiers who were hiding everywhere.

   Minka, who was hiding under the boulder, took a breath of the pungent smoke from the explosion, and coughed twice.

  The sound of shouting came, and some people wearing **** monster masks ran out from the ravine in the mountains.

  They held all kinds of weapons in their hands, and frantically fired towards the imperial troops.

   There was a howling sound of tearing the air from the sky.

  Three fighter planes sprayed with profane patterns roared past.

   Directly fired missiles at the 101st regiment where Minka was.

  A series of explosions sounded, submerging the 101 regiment in a sea of ​​flames.

  Communications heard some soldiers moaning in pain, pleading for medical assistance.

   "Attention all units, we are under attack by traitors. Bring up tanks and heavy artillery, we need it, fire team, shoot down those fighter planes, don't let them escape."

  The commander's angry voice came from the comm.

   Obviously, being suddenly attacked by traitors also made the commander furious.

   This is yet another humiliation to Cadia's honor.

   Absolutely unforgiving.

  Minka crouched under the boulder, and escaped several blows from the enemy by chance.

  She poked her head out cautiously.

   Saw those **** traitors running over from hundreds of meters away.

  Profane writing is painted on their bodies.

   While shooting at the 101st regiment, he was also holding a twisted monster sculpture, yelling.

   Seems like that will attract the gods and give them some blessings.

   "The target of the traitor was found, due east, there are estimated to be about 100 people, only 400 meters away from us, they are approaching us." Minka said to the communication device.

   "Get rid of them." The commander's voice came from the communication, "Don't let those **** go, let them know that the honor of Cadia cannot be tarnished."

   "Understood." Minka said.

  At this time, Vardy and several other survivors also crawled over from the side.

  After a few simple instructions, they cooperated with each other tacitly.

  According to the usual training.

   They started forming shooting squads and shooting those **** traitors.

  The equipment of Cadia is the first echelon among the many regiments of the empire.

   Many forging worlds will give priority to supplying high-quality equipment to Cadia.

  So that the Cadians can defend the first fortress of humans and the Eye of Terror.

  Although the Cadians failed, their excellent equipment was not recovered.

  The reason is that they have a new mission, which is to go to all parts of the galaxy to fight against the enemies of the empire.

   This is their salvation.

  The fall of the Cadia fortress is a sin they need to spend their entire lives to pay for.

  Failure is failure.

   Whatever the reason, they failed the Emperor's trust.

  The surviving Cadians all believed in one thing.

   They need to fight until the last Cadian dies.

  The emperor will forgive their mistakes and accept all Cadia heroes.

   Until then, they must fight for the Emperor as best they can.

  Only in this way can salvation be obtained.

   "Go to hell, traitor," Minka said, aiming at a yelling guy and pulling the trigger.

   With the flash of the carbine barrel.

   The cultist she targeted fell directly to the ground.

  Through the scope, Minka could see a small hole pierced through the opponent's head.

   Carbine laser gun does not need to calculate trajectory and direction.

   Aim and shoot, that is, a straight line.

  Valdy and others also opened fire one after another, and those traitors fell down in a short while.

   Minka, Vardy and others couldn't help but high-five.

   "You know the Cadians are powerful."

   "Haha, run quickly."

   But soon, they ushered in the traitor's revenge.

   A shell landed near them.

  The boulders they were hiding in were blown to pieces, and the gravel flew.

  Minka was also blown away by the huge shock wave and fell into the bushes.

  The huge sonic boom made her brain buzz.

  The whole person is a little confused.

   When I got up, my whole face was burning with pain.

  She fired a few more shots at the person in that direction.

   With the sound of lasers piercing the air, several traitors fell.

   Seeing that the shelling could not destroy Minka and the others, the traitors ran away like frightened birds and beasts.

  Maybe they thought they had encountered an undead ghost.

   They all fired shells and survived the explosion, and they can still fight back, which is terrible.

   Seeing the traitor fleeing, Minka did not continue shooting.

  She ran to Vardy's position to see how he was doing.

  In the original hiding place, there is only a scorched black pit left.

  The sound of moaning came from the bushes next to a highway.

   Minka walked over and saw Vardy who had been stabbed in the chest by sharp stone fragments.

  He lay there in the bushes.

   His complexion was pale, and sweat was constantly oozing from his forehead.

  The wound was bleeding continuously.

   Obviously, he was in pain.

   "Valdy." Minka's voice was full of grief, "It shouldn't be like this, how could you!"

   "It's okay." Valdy saw Minka with a terrified and sad face, and tried to comfort him, but his tone was pale and filled with suppressed pain.

   After saying a few words, he began to vomit blood.

   "No! You hold on." Minka stopped Vardy, and she yelled into the comm for the medics to come.

   "You have to work **** your own, Minka. From now on, you are no longer a recruit, you know?? You have to be alone. Remember that the glory of Cadia is eternal, and we can no longer fail the Emperor."

  Valdy looked at the little girl in front of him, exhausted his last strength, and made his final entrustment.

   There was a trace of pity for Minka in his heart.

   It's been a full plan, and this girl has only been in the army for a few months.

  How cruel fate is to her.

  The Great Marauder used Blackstone Hold to smash the entire planet of Cadia to pieces right in front of her.

   In the first battle, I saw many of my companions die.

   Now, she just came out of Cadia's failure, but fell into another abyss.

   Now, she has to live on Cadia's honor.

   This path is painful.

   And she must bear the suffering of this life.

  When the medical soldiers ran over.

  Valdy has stopped breathing.

   There was a trace of peace on his face.

  Wife, child, and comrades-in-arms all died in the Battle of Cadia.

  And he shouldered the task of restoring the morale and combat power of the lost Cadia 101 regiment.

   Keeping him busy.

  His friends and relatives are all dead.

   But he is not even qualified to be sad.

   As one of the few remaining veterans, his sadness will inevitably lower the morale of the 101st Cadia Regiment.

  Death is a terrible thing.

   But for those who have lost everything and carry heavy burdens, it is undoubtedly a relief.

  Two Chimera personnel carriers and a Leman Rustan tank came from behind and bombarded the possible artillery positions.

   After a while, the alarm was declared lifted.

  The traitors were all wiped out.

  The fighter plane was also shot down, and the wreckage burned violently on the plain.

  The 101st Cadia Regiment regrouped.

   This is a small attack.

   Although successfully repelled, and achieved a very good record.

   But the morale of the 101st Regiment generally declined.

   Before entering the position, casualties were caused, which is undoubtedly a huge blow to morale.

   Minka was worried about whether they would be able to win, and also felt a little sad for the dead comrades.

   It's a pity that we are now in a war period.

  She didn't even have time to mourn for her comrades.

  Buried the body in a hurry, collected the nameplate of the deceased, and continued on the road.

  The 101st and other Cadian regiments were quickly ordered to attack a traitor-controlled hive city.

  They're going to take it back.

  The enemy wears uniforms with weird symbols, claiming to bring a new baptism to mankind and usher in a new era.

  The enemy has set up barriers in the streets and city buildings.

   Those imperial civilians who did not have time to escape the city during the rebellion became their hostages.

   Forced to take up arms, or charge Cadian soldiers with bombs strapped to their bodies.

  The commander showed no mercy, and directly ordered heavy tanks and personnel carriers to run over the civilians.

  Minka followed the troops to launch an attack on the hive capital.

  She adjusted the gun to fully automatic mode, and the hot light bullets sent out a series of lasers to impact the fortifications built by the traitors.

   She charged with another 20 Cadian soldiers.

  Everyone shoots like she does, with good aim.

   The traitors have not received much training, but their firepower equipment is good, with heavy automatic guns and parallel double-barreled artillery.

   It's a pity that these traitors are not facing ordinary imperial troops.

   But Cadia soldiers.

  One of the most elite troops in the empire.

  Every man and woman born in Cadia has learned how to fight for as long as he can remember, so as to take up arms to defend their homeland and be ready to fight back Chaos at any time.

  Cadia's daily life is training, rest, training, rest, and fighting.

  They are battle-hardened and experienced.

  If the fall of Cadia hadn't taken away too many veterans, the defenders of the hive capital would have lost more bleakly and more quickly.

  Minka and others charged forward.

  Three rebels were killed by her, and one was knocked down by her.

   Minka rushed up and stabbed the opponent's throat with a bayonet, and bright red blood gushed out.

  She could clearly see that the other party was only seventeen or eighteen years old.

  The traitor covered his pierced throat, his expression extremely terrified.

   "You shouldn't have betrayed." Minka said, "Even if you die a thousand times, you shouldn't have betrayed."

  The young traitor's eyes widened, and then he lost his breath.

  The vehicles of the Empire moved forward with a rumbling sound, and the artillery fire continued to bombard the traitors.

   Soon, the traitors couldn't bear to leave, and they retreated steadily.

  Even with the civilians of the hive city as cover, it is difficult for them to defend the hive city.

  Many war machines attacked the rebel fortifications one after another.

  The ferocious artillery bombardment continued day and night for more than ten days, reducing the buildings outside the strategic targets to ruins.

  Personnel carriers and super-heavy tanks act as the vanguard, and with the rumbling sound, they run over the enemy's corpses all the way, and bombard the enemies hidden in the building.

  The Cadia corps advanced step by step, and the rebels were forced to abandon a large number of fortifications and corpses, and fled to the inner city in a panic.

  Minka thought that victory would come here.

  They will easily take back the hive city and complete their mission.

   Until she sees the cultists pushing the crosses that bind civilians appear.

   Minka realized once again that his imagination of the danger of the galaxy was too simple.

   Those civilians were tied naked to the cross by the heretics using wire with blades and thorns.

   Those people kept screaming in pain and begging for mercy.

   Hopefully the cultists will get around them.

  The cultists ignored them.

   Instead, around these sufferers, they danced all kinds of weird dances like a great god, praying with words.

  The experienced commander recognized at a glance that the cultists were offering sacrifices to the demons in the rift, begging for their strength.

  He ordered the troops to speed up the attack.

   However, it was still a step behind.

  Accompanied by the weird spells of those guys, the evil magic was released to its heart's content.

   Some horrible monsters rushed out of the shadows.

  The dense swarm of insects like a torrential rain covered the sky and the sun, rushing towards the Cadia troops.

   Block the air intake, muzzle, goggles, nose, ears and eyes.

  The drinking water boiled out of thin air, the engines were overheated and overloaded, and they burned down one after another.

  Many soldiers became hard stone statues, or became soft and boneless, or their skin and flesh rotted.

   Some fell into madness, others into twisted monsters.

   If there is a slight carelessness in government affairs, these people will kill each other.

  The swarms of bugs crawled everywhere, spreading madly.

  As the battle progressed, the soldiers were covered with pustules, and then their bodies and minds changed, turning them into terrifying demons.

   Just like the filthy monsters in weird myths.

  The dead stood up again, with a ferocious face, and rushed to his former comrades-in-arms, chewing their **** bones.

   This is a battle of supernatural powers used.

  The Cadia soldiers, who were already sure of winning, were forced to leave the hive in embarrassment, losing all the fruits of their previous victories.

  Those terrifying things are definitely not their means to resist, if they continue to stay, they will only cause more severe deaths and injuries.

  Minka watched as the monsters devoured his companions.

   Overturning the super-heavy Leman Russ tank, this is by no means a terrifying monster that manpower can fight.

   "Those sacks are pulling us into a fight we can't win."

   When Minka withdrew with the troops, he said to the soldiers next to him.

   It's not that she disrespects her boss and fears death.

  Those terrifying monsters are obviously beyond the scope of manpower.

  The officials of the Conny galaxy should not be looking for the Cadia Corps, but the Demon Tribunal.

  Only the Demon Tribunal can fight against these hateful monsters.

   Forced to do nothing, the commanders can only blockade those hives with traitors.

  The rebels launched an attack every once in a while.

   Trying to break through the blockade.

  Minka originally thought that the Conny galaxy would become a long-lasting battlefield.

   She found herself wrong again.

   After a stalemate for a while, the traitors launched another attack on the blockade.

   This time, they dragged the altar of sacrifice, and brought the wizards with them.

   On the battlefield, those terrifying monsters were summoned.

  Try to use witchcraft to break the blockade of the empire.

   The snipers hide in the dark and kill all the wizards who dare to take the lead.

  However, the enemy still charged the imperial defense line with the help of weird witchcraft.

Roar!

  The roar of the beast sounded.

  Those terrifying monsters and mutants swarmed out and pounced on the imperial troops.

  The tank was blown away by them, and the personnel carrier was also blown up.

  The Cadians stood firm with their crude fortifications, and fought almost crazily against the traitors who used witchcraft.

   They quickly rushed to the Cadian position.

   Indiscriminately slashed around and trampled the wounded underfoot.

  Minka and other soldiers mounted bayonets and made the last resistance.

   Stab supernatural foes with insane determination.

   Just when Minka thought they could no longer contain the demons.

   There was a vibration from the ground, and a series of streamers bombarded the positions full of enemies.

  Several steaming orbital airborne pods stood airtight on the battlefield.

  Traitor bullets hit it without causing any damage at all.

  Accompanied by the dull metal collision and the hiss of depressurization, the hatch of the airborne cabin slowly opened.

  Accompanied by the hissing of high-pressure gas, the giant in black power armor stepped out of the airborne cabin.

  They are more than two meters long, holding chainsaw swords and bolt guns.

  Minka was stunned for a moment. As a Cadia warrior, she naturally knew what these guys were.

  Emperor's Angel, Empire's Sword, Man's Enemy's Nemesis.

  She can even recognize the opponent's identity from the opponent's armor emblem.

   "Black, Dark Angel." Minka stammered.

   Those who came were none other than the first legion of supermen created by the Emperor, the Dark Angels.

  They are carefully selected warriors in the universe. They have undergone various surgeries and implanted biological carapaces, allowing them to control the power armor like a second skin.

  Similar giants came out of the airborne pod.

   Standing behind the first fighter, they formed a wide fan.

   The Space Marine at the forefront is the only one without a helmet.

  He looked towards the battlefield with serious eyes.

   "It's that devil's breath again, what exactly does it want to do!" the leading dark angel said to himself.

   Then he ordered the Emperor's Angels to join the battle.

  No doubts.

  The space fighters in black power armor rushed towards the position where the battle was most intense.

   They crossed the huge crater in one step, and fired a burst of precise bombs with each step forward.

  The aura of the rebels was shattered in an instant.

  Even the monsters they summoned were sent back to the warp directly by the dark angels, posing no threat at all.

  The body of the traitor couldn't withstand the attack of the explosive bomb at all, and half of his body would be blown to pieces.

   At the end, the huge Dreadnought also joined the battlefield along with the Emperor Angel.

   With heavy steps, he crushed all the traitors blocking his way.

  Some think tanks with scepters summon supernatural powers more terrifying than traitors to drive back all those disgusting monsters.

   "Counterattack." The commander's order came from the communication.

  Minka and the other Cadian soldiers fought back with the warriors of the Dark Angels Chapter.

  Dark Angel strode at the forefront of the palace, wielding a chainsaw sword and regular salvos of explosive bombs to reap the retreating traitors.

   Cadian soldiers raised their lasguns high and shot at those fish that slipped through the net.

   The traitor's retreat quickly turned into a rout.

  They fled all the way into the inner city, trying to use the inner city to defend.

   It's a pity that their witchcraft no longer works in front of the Dark Angels.

  The Librarians of the Dark Angels Squad have performed ancient techniques far superior to theirs.

   interrupted their sacrificial rituals, and caused those poor wizards to suffer backlash.

  With the help of the Dark Angels, the Cadia soldiers who had been frustrated at first reversed the situation and regained the hive capital.

   Watch as captive cultists are led out for execution.

  Minka couldn't help being in awe of the terrifying combat power of the space fighters.

   "I'm Minka, the company commander of the 101st Regiment of Cadia, thank you for your help." Minka said.

  Hearing the name Cadia, the Space Marine looked at Minka for a moment, "Dark Angel Deathwing, Tactical Squad, Boris."

"Thank you again, Master Boris." Minka said, "Do you need our assistance?" "No." Boris said, "We are chasing a demon. If you don't want your comrades to die or get injured, Then don't get involved."

   "Understood, my lord," Minka said.

  Boris looked around.

  The whole nest is full of black smoke, and the fire has not been extinguished.

   Things are going badly.

  Boris knew that all of this was led by the devil, so it happened.

   So far, they have received a lot of information about calling for help.

  The initial information even bears the title of Fallen Angel, which involves Caliban regulations.

   For this reason, the Grand Master of the Dark Angels Chapter, the heir to the Lion King's Sword and Lion King's Helmet-Azrael sent the Deathwing Company to track it down.

  Boris is also one of them.

  He tracked down all the way.

   The more I investigate, the more confused I become.

  He did not find any trace of the fallen angel.

   Only traces of demons were found.

   "The interrogation came out, found it, it's deep in the hive."

  The voice of the think tank came from the communication device of the helmet.

   A coordinate is sent to the personal database.

  Boris led the other team members towards the coordinates.

  No matter what, he must catch this demon.
